Local Action

Matching good governance and climate change mitigation

by Pedro Ballesteros Torres
European Commission, DG ENER / A3
Initiator of the Covenant of Mayors

The Covenant of Mayors is a most successful network of mayors committed to the respect of the urban environment. It is the mainstream European movement involving local and regional authorities, voluntarily committing to increasing energy efficiency and use of renewable energy sources in their territories. By their commitment, Covenant signatories - representing more than 5000 cities in 48 countries - aim to meet and exceed the European Union 20% CO2 reduction objective by 2020. It has been translated into specific action plans http://www.covenantofmayors.eu/actions/sustainable-energy-action-plans_en.html.

Pedro Ballesteros is now expanding it to other continents and will deliver a message of pragmatic optimism about thrifty opportunities for better governance while mitigating climate change. He is Engineer in Food Industry from the Universidad Politécnica of Madrid, and has a MBA in Energy Business. He worked as consultant in energy and environment topics for the EU and United Nations from 1984 to 1994, at the European Commission since 1995. Before assuming his present duties he was responsible of the OPET Network for energy technologies, the network of local and regional energy agencies, the Intelligent Energy Europe programme, and the Sustainable Energy Europe Campaign and the Covenant of Mayors. At present he is in charge of the EU-China Urbanisation Partnership, as well as the launch of a global Covenant of Mayors and energy relations with Latin America and India.
